Belgrade Public Transport Unions Protest City's Treatment of Drivers
Three trade unions of Belgrade's Public Transport Company (GSP) have stated that the City of Belgrade is "favoring private companies while punishing GSP drivers," criticizing the removal of driver bonuses through changes to the Collective Agreement.
